Module A Fire Hose And Appliances (4-12) Firefighter III Module A Fire Hose And Appliances (4-12)

a) To reduce the size of a hose: 3-6.1. Identify the adapters and appliances to be used in three specific fire ground situations: (4-12.2) I. Selecting adapters: a) To reduce the size of a hose: i) Determine the size of the current hose line. ii) Determine the size of hose line needed. iii) Connect appropriate reducer to current hose line. iv) Connect desired hose line to reducer.

b) Divide one line into two lines of the same size: 3-6.1. Identify the adapters and appliances to be used in three specific fire ground situations: (4-12.2) b) Divide one line into two lines of the same size: i) Determine the size of current hose line. ii) Determine the size of hose line needed. iii) Connect proper size wye to the current hose line. iv) Connect desired hose lines to wye. v) Station a firefighter at the wye to control the valves

-6.1. Identify the adapters and appliances to be used in three specific fire ground situations: (4-12.2) c) Divide one line into several lines of different sizes: i) Determine size of current hose line. ii) Determine size of hose lines needed. iii) Connect proper size water thief to current hose line. iv) Connect desired hose lines to water thief. v) Station firefighter at wye to control valves.

d) Supply a single hose line with two or more hose lines: -6.1. Identify the adapters and appliances to be used in three specific fire ground situations: (4-12.2) d) Supply a single hose line with two or more hose lines: i) Determine size of supply hose lines. ii) Determine size of hose line to be supplied. iii) Connect supply hose line to Siamese. iv) Connect supplied hose line to Siamese.

e) Connect two couplings of same sex together: -6.1. Identify the adapters and appliances to be used in three specific fire ground situations: (4-12.2) e) Connect two couplings of same sex together: i) Determine sex of couplings. ii) Select a double male if the sex is female, or a double female if the sex is male. iii) Connect the couplings to the appropriate fitting.
